[Press Release] G.SKILL will showcase its latest DDR5 innovations and host thrilling overclocking competitions at Computex 2025, which will take Place May 20–23 at Nangang Exhibition Centre, Hall 1 (Tainex 1), Booth J0818.

G.SKILL will highlight its newest DDR5 memory kits, optimized for peak performance on the latest Intel and AMD platforms. 

Top professional overclockers will push hardware to the limit using LN2 cooling, G.SKILL DDR5 memory, and motherboards from ASRock, ASUS, GIGABYTE, and MSI. This live showcase will demonstrate extreme system tuning and potential world-record achievements.

Nine elite overclockers will compete live using G.SKILL DDR5, Intel® Core Ultra processors, and Z890 motherboards for a share of $40,000 USD:

  • Champion: $10,000
  • 2nd–9th Place: $6,500 to $2,500

The winner will be crowned on May 23 at 2:30 PM at the G.SKILL booth. Ten custom-built, themed PC mods by top global modders will be on display, celebrating the modding community’s creativity and craftsmanship. Check out G.SKILL’s website for more information.
